Title: LLM Markdown – Expose Content as .md
Author: Michael Sablone
Published: <strong>Hwevrer 26, 2026</strong>
Last modified: Hwevrer 26, 2026

---

Search plugins

![](https://ps.w.org/llm-markdown/assets/banner-772x250.png?rev=3470711)

![](https://ps.w.org/llm-markdown/assets/icon-256x256.png?rev=3470711)

# LLM Markdown – Expose Content as .md

 By [Michael Sablone](https://profiles.wordpress.org/michaelsablone/)

[Download](https://downloads.wordpress.org/plugin/llm-markdown.1.0.0.zip)

 * [Details](https://cor.wordpress.org/plugins/llm-markdown/#description)
 * [Reviews](https://cor.wordpress.org/plugins/llm-markdown/#reviews)
 *  [Installation](https://cor.wordpress.org/plugins/llm-markdown/#installation)
 * [Development](https://cor.wordpress.org/plugins/llm-markdown/#developers)

 [Support](https://wordpress.org/support/plugin/llm-markdown/)

## Description

LLM Markdown exposes your public WordPress posts and pages as real `.md` routes.
Simply append .md to any supported post or page URL to access its Markdown representation.

Each Markdown document includes structured YAML front matter and clean content extracted
from the rendered HTML.

Designed for:

 * LLM and AI ingestion
 * Headless and hybrid workflows
 * Content export pipelines
 * SEO-friendly alternate representations

Example:

    ```
    https://example.com/my-post.md
    ```

Features:

 * Real `.md` URLs
 * YAML front matter (title, dates, taxonomy, URL)
 * Selector-based content extraction
 * Respects password protection
 * Optional respect for noindex
 * Per-post-type control
 * Caching for performance
 * Adds `<link rel="alternate" type="text/markdown">`

No Gutenberg lock-in. No content duplication. No custom post types required.

## Screenshots

 * [[
 * Settings screen (post types and selectors)

## Installation

 1. Upload the plugin folder to `/wp-content/plugins/`
 2. Activate the plugin
 3. Visit Settings  Markdown Output to configure options

After activation, append `.md` to supported post URLs.

## FAQ

### Does this help LLMs index my content?

The plugin exposes a structured Markdown representation of your content. How LLMs
discover and use it depends on the model or crawler.

### Does this modify my content?

No. The plugin generates Markdown dynamically from rendered HTML.

### Does it support custom post types?

Yes. Any public post type can be enabled in settings.

### Does it expose private content?

No. Password-protected and non-public content are excluded.

### Is this intended for SEO?

It provides an alternate Markdown representation. Search engine behavior may vary.

## Reviews

![](https://secure.gravatar.com/avatar/9373958895fcac485d0073fe1f95ca37272ecf52a57d8d624a820c3b9f5a6a6b?
s=60&d=retro&r=g)

### 󠀁[Outstanding Results!](https://wordpress.org/support/topic/outstanding-results/)󠁿

 [lobozebra](https://profiles.wordpress.org/lobozebra/) Ebrel 5, 2026

I installed this plugin on my site a few months ago and have noticed LLM traffic
ramping up nearly 25%! It does exactly what it is supposed to do extremely well 
and does not add any unnecessary bloat to my WordPress instance.

 [ Read all 1 review ](https://wordpress.org/support/plugin/llm-markdown/reviews/)

## Contributors & Developers

“LLM Markdown – Expose Content as .md” is open source software. The following people
have contributed to this plugin.

Contributors

 *   [ Michael Sablone ](https://profiles.wordpress.org/michaelsablone/)

[Translate “LLM Markdown – Expose Content as .md” into your language.](https://translate.wordpress.org/projects/wp-plugins/llm-markdown)

### Interested in development?

[Browse the code](https://plugins.trac.wordpress.org/browser/llm-markdown/), check
out the [SVN repository](https://plugins.svn.wordpress.org/llm-markdown/), or subscribe
to the [development log](https://plugins.trac.wordpress.org/log/llm-markdown/) by
[RSS](https://plugins.trac.wordpress.org/log/llm-markdown/?limit=100&mode=stop_on_copy&format=rss).

## Changelog

#### 1.0.0

 * Initial release.

## Meta

 *  Version **1.0.0**
 *  Last updated **1 mis ago**
 *  Active installations **20+**
 *  WordPress version ** 6.0 or higher **
 *  Tested up to **6.9.4**
 *  PHP version ** 7.4 or higher **
 *  Language
 * [English (US)](https://wordpress.org/plugins/llm-markdown/)
 * Tags
 * [AI](https://cor.wordpress.org/plugins/tags/ai/)[content export](https://cor.wordpress.org/plugins/tags/content-export/)
   [headless](https://cor.wordpress.org/plugins/tags/headless/)[LLM](https://cor.wordpress.org/plugins/tags/llm/)
   [markdown](https://cor.wordpress.org/plugins/tags/markdown/)
 *  [Advanced View](https://cor.wordpress.org/plugins/llm-markdown/advanced/)

## Ratings

 5 out of 5 stars.

 *  [  1 5-star review     ](https://wordpress.org/support/plugin/llm-markdown/reviews/?filter=5)
 *  [  0 4-star reviews     ](https://wordpress.org/support/plugin/llm-markdown/reviews/?filter=4)
 *  [  0 3-star reviews     ](https://wordpress.org/support/plugin/llm-markdown/reviews/?filter=3)
 *  [  0 2-star reviews     ](https://wordpress.org/support/plugin/llm-markdown/reviews/?filter=2)
 *  [  0 1-star reviews     ](https://wordpress.org/support/plugin/llm-markdown/reviews/?filter=1)

[Add my review](https://wordpress.org/support/plugin/llm-markdown/reviews/#new-post)

[See all reviews](https://wordpress.org/support/plugin/llm-markdown/reviews/)

## Contributors

 *   [ Michael Sablone ](https://profiles.wordpress.org/michaelsablone/)

## Support

Got something to say? Need help?

 [View support forum](https://wordpress.org/support/plugin/llm-markdown/)

## Donate

Would you like to support the advancement of this plugin?

 [ Donate to this plugin ](https://www.paypal.com/donate/?hosted_button_id=EUHE8NXYEXJJ6)